Summary
We are seeking a Senior LLM Infrastructure and DevOps Engineer to architect, deploy, and maintain large scale generative AI systems across AWS and GCP. This role focuses on LLM inference pipelines, multi agent orchestration, infra as code, and cloud native automation. You will own the reliability, security, and scalability of all infrastructure supporting N1’s AI driven report generation platform.
This is an advanced role for an engineer deeply familiar with deploying production LLM workflows, optimizing cloud spend for generative AI, and implementing secure, highly available multi cloud systems.
Core Requirements
• Infrastructure diagramming and architecture ownership
• 8 plus years in DevOps or CloudOps, including containerized and distributed deployments
• Expert in Terraform, GitHub Actions, AWS CDK, and GCP deployment workflows
• Strong experience with AWS CodePipelines
• Full management of AWS services (IAM, ECS or Fargate, S3, Bedrock)
• Strong experience with GCP services (Cloud Run, Batch with batch job management, Firestore)
• Advanced Docker, CI or CD, and automated build and deploy pipelines
• Proven experience deploying LLM systems at scale, including Bedrock, Claude, Gemini, Hugging Face, and others via LiteLLM
• Security expertise: IAM policies, secrets management, audit logging, intrusion detection
• Deep experience with cost control for LLM inference workloads
• Experience with AWS CloudWatch, Cost Explorer, and model usage tracking
• Ability to implement model spend monitoring (LiteLLM or equivalent)
• Familiarity with prompt management systems like Bedrock Prompt Management
• Ability to enforce provider specific quotas (Gemini token limits, request quotas, etc.)
• Ability to integrate new model endpoints including Imagen 3, Google Multimodal, grok 3 beta
• Strong debugging skills for LLM inference failures, image generation issues, and vector fallback logic (Weaviate, ChromaDB)
Additional Required Experience
• Fluent in switching and deploying across LLM providers (OpenAI, Google, Anthropic, DeepSeek)
• Experience deploying secure HTTP or HTTPS transports and server sent events
• Ability to diagnose failures across distributed file processing and LLM extraction pipelines
• Proficiency with multimodal API constraints and data governance requirements
• Experience handling rapid model deprecations or replacements
• Strong cross functional collaboration with backend and data engineering teams
Deliverables
Complete infrastructure diagrams for AWS and GCP environments
Production grade LLM inference pipelines with automated CI or CD
Fully coded Terraform or CDK infrastructure modules
Stable and optimized multi agent LLM orchestration deployed across providers
Model cost monitoring dashboards and LLM usage reporting
Logging and monitoring improvements for distributed extraction pipelines
Robust fallback logic for vector database layers (Weaviate, ChromaDB)
Secure IAM configurations and documented secret management workflows
Automated model quota enforcement and routing logic
Documentation for deployment processes, rollback plans, and disaster recovery
Cost reduction strategies validated in production
Stable cross cloud collaboration pipelines with backend or data teams
